An initiative to develop bespoke antibiotics for livestock has raised fears that it could be a techno-fix for more intensive farming.
Mixed reactions have followed news that Ineos, a global petrochemical manufacturer, has donated £100m to establish the Ineos Oxford University Institute (IOI) for antimicrobial research.
